How many international students come to UK every year?
In 2021-22, there were 679,970 international students studying at UK higher education institutions. 120,140 of these students were from the EU and 559,825 were non-EU students. Chinese students made up the largest group of international students with 151,690 studying in the UK in 2021-22.Why studying in UK is better than USA?

In 2021/22 there were 679,970 overseas students studying at UK universities, 120,140 of whom were from the EU and 559,825 from elsewhere. This was another new record total and 24% of the total student population.How many US students study in the UK?
From Africa, there are 68,320 international students enrolled in higher education studies. There are currently 37,655 international students coming from the Middle East. The total number of international students from North America in the UK is 35,330.Which country sends the most students to UK?
China sent a record number of 151,690 students to the United Kingdom in 2021-22, more than any other country or alliance, including the European Union, according to the latest data from UK-based Higher Education Statistics Agency, or HESA.How many immigrants came to UK in 2023?
The provisional estimate of total long-term immigration for year ending (YE) June 2023 was 1.2 million, while emigration was 508,000, meaning that net migration was 672,000; most people arriving to the UK in the YE June 2023 were non-EU nationals (968,000), followed by EU (129,000) and British (84,000).What nationality are most immigrants to the UK?
